The Journey Begins: Comfort and Convenience
The experience starts with hotel pickup in Prague, which is a major plus. No need to worry about navigating public transport or arranging taxis; your friendly, English-speaking driver will be waiting to whisk you off in a late-model, comfortable vehicle. This private transfer ensures a smooth start, with just enough time on the road—about four hours—to relax, enjoy scenic views, or even catch a nap before arriving in Vienna.
Once you reach Vienna, the real adventure begins. Your guide, who is fully customizable in terms of itinerary, will provide insights into the city’s architecture, history, and culture. The flexibility here is key—if you’re particularly interested in the Hofburg Palace or St. Stephen’s Cathedral, your guide can focus more on those areas.
Highlights of Vienna You Can Expect
The tour covers the most famous sights of Vienna, many of which are UNESCO World Heritage sites. You’ll get a good overview of the city’s Gothic and Baroque architecture, from the impressive spires of St. Stephen’s Cathedral to the grandeur of Hofburg Palace. The Vienna Opera House, City Hall (Rathaus), and the Austrian Parliament are all on the list, painted as much in history as in their striking facades.
The 3-hour private walking tour is where you really get a sense of Vienna’s soul. Walking through the city streets, your guide will point out hidden gems and share stories behind these landmarks—making the experience more than just a visual tour. The guide’s focus on your interests means you might spend extra time in the Museum Quarter if art is your thing or relax in Palace Gardens if you’re after some serene moments.

The Practical Details
The tour lasts approximately 12 hours, with starting times depending on availability. It includes hotel pickup and drop-off, so your day begins and ends hassle-free. A professional English-speaking guide is included, along with a friendly driver and private transportation in a comfort vehicle.
Food and drinks are not included, so plan to bring snacks or plan for a meal in Vienna. Museum admission fees are also extra, so if you want to visit specific attractions, you may need to add those costs separately.
The tour is wheelchair accessible, which broadens its appeal. Booking flexibility is another benefit—you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, and there’s an option to reserve now and pay later.

FAQs
Is this tour suitable for solo travelers?
Yes, but the price is based on a two-person group, so if you’re solo, the cost might be higher per person. It’s ideal for couples or small groups wanting a private experience.
How long is the drive from Prague to Vienna?
The round-trip drive takes around 4 hours each way, making the total tour about 12 hours including sightseeing and free time.
What’s included in the price?
Your private guide, all customized tours, hotel pickup and drop-off, private transportation in a comfort vehicle, and a 3-hour private walking tour.
Are meals included?
No, food and drinks are not included. Travelers should bring their own snacks or plan to dine in Vienna.
Can I customize the itinerary?
Absolutely. The tour is fully customizable, so you can focus on the sights that interest you most.
Is this tour wheelchair accessible?
Yes, it is wheelchair accessible, making it suitable for travelers with mobility needs.
What should I bring?
A passport or ID card is necessary for the trip, along with any personal items, snacks, and comfortable walking shoes.
What if I need to cancel?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
Is this a group tour?
No, this is a private tour, designed exclusively for your group, ensuring personalized attention and flexibility.
How far in advance should I book?
Availability can vary, so it’s best to reserve as early as possible, especially during peak travel seasons.
